  15. Uncle Leo is spot on. Falcon's generally aren't as fast or powerful versus other brands of the same power rating. I would go up at least one power rating. FYI....the Bucoo is said to be the Falcon Original blank packaged in a split grip format. i have all 3 series of rods and i agree with the Original not being as fast as others. it is IMO still a good entry level rod for lighter finesse plastics. my Lowrider is a M/M so its hard to compare speed. the Cara T7 seems to be plenty fast. ive only tossed 5/16 oz jigs on the rod but id say theres a good tip there. on the other hand, ive yet to use a really good heavy jig rod.......so...
